IPhone võib olla kiirem kui tundub. Kõik tõsised iOS-i rakenduste arendajad juba teavad sellest, kuid enamik inimesi, kellega olen kokku puutunud, pole sellest teadlikud.
Apple'il kindlasti on värskendas iOS-i seadmetes olevat riistvara aastate jooksul. Kuid kas riistvara suurenemine võrreldes nähtava või reklaamitava kiiruse suurenemisega on suurem? Võib-olla, kuid teisest küljest võib sellel olla midagi pistmist Apple'i funktsiooniga, mis algab iOS 3.0-ga.
Iga kord, kui rakendus suletakse, teeb iOS ekraanipildi. Rakenduse käivitamisel kuvatakse ekraanipildi varundamine hetkega, kui tõeline rakendus laaditakse taustal. Kõigile, kes seda süsteemi kasutavad, ilmub see lihtsalt nii, nagu rakendus koheselt laadib, kuid tegelikkuses on see ekraanipildi pisipilt, mis peidab tegelikku laadimist. See on tõesti üsna nutikas ja funktsioon on piisavalt hästi peidetud, et enamik inimesi isegi ei mõtle sellele. Enamasti pole see isegi märgatav, kuid suurte (aeglaselt laaditavate) rakendustega on aeg-ajalt tõrge. Kui rakendus ei lae piisavalt kiiresti, tundub ekraan mõneks sekundiks külmunud, kuna ekraanipilt ei saa puutetundlikule sisendile reageerida.
Kuigi ma tean, et Apple kasutab seda väikest jõudluse petmist, paneb see iOS-i siiski kiiremini tundma. Ja see näeb kindlasti kiirem välja, sest kui teil pole iPhone'i diagnoosimisvahendi külge haakunud, on jõudluse ainus indikaator visuaalne.
Apple ei peatunud selle trikkiga vaid iOS-is. Puudutussõbralike Macide jaoks mõeldud Safari kasutab ka sarnast hetktõmmise laadimispuhvrit. Lihtsaim viis selle nägemiseks MacBook Pro kasutamisel on kasutada Google Instanti otsingutulemusi. Kui klõpsate lingil ja libistate siis eelmisele lehele tagasi sirvimiseks, viibib see mõni sekund, kuid see pole siiski midagi, mida on lihtne märgata.
Üldiselt mulle see funktsioon meeldib, kuna igal juhul võtab mind aklimatiseeruda hiljuti käivitatud rakendus. Ainus kord, kui see on valusalt ilmne, on Jailbrokeni seadmetel, kus normaalne jõudlus on pärast järelturutarkvara modifikatsioone pisut vähenenud.